Pantheon Platform
RepVue Score
0
Pantheon Platform
Back to ReviewsCurrent Employee My overall experience was good. Recent changes by leadership have improved operations and there is opportunity to succeed. Browse Other Reviews
2.7
Feb 21, 2024
Useful